This lithograph print takes us back in time to the year 1812, showcasing the picturesque beauty of Harlem Plains in New York. The American artist skillfully captures the essence of this early landscape, transporting us to a serene countryside that once existed amidst bustling city life. As we gaze upon this artwork from 1856, we are immediately struck by the vastness and tranquility of the scene. Rolling hills stretch as far as the eye can see, adorned with lush forests and scattered trees that paint a vibrant tapestry across the plains. In the middle ground lies a gentle river, meandering through this idyllic setting like a lifeline connecting nature's elements. The harmonious blend of natural elements and human touch is evident in every detail captured by this lithograph. It offers a glimpse into an era when New York was still developing its urban identity while preserving pockets of untouched wilderness within its borders.
